titleOfInvention | UV curable resin composition and method for producing laminated film |
abstract | An object of the present invention is to provide a self-assembled microstructure, in which a heat curing step of a thermosetting resin in an insulating smoothing layer forming step or the like is performed as a pre-process of an IC chip interconnection process after the IC chip is assembled. Provided is an ultraviolet-curable resin composition for use in manufacturing a laminated film having a microstructure self-assembling function capable of suppressing a change in physical properties, and a method for producing the laminated film using the composition and a laminated film. An ultraviolet curable resin composition laminated on a cyclic olefin resin film as a lower layer material to form a cured film as an upper layer material, wherein a photopolymerization initiator contained in the composition is benzophenone. An initiator comprising a specific polybenzophenone compound having two or more structures in one molecule. Further, a laminated film using the composition as a molding layer is provided.
